Biography

Tanya Bondarenko is an Assistant Professor in the Department of Linguistics at Harvard University, where she also serves as the Director of the WOLF Lab. Her research focuses on aspects of syntax and semantics, contributing to studies in various language families including Algonquian, Altaic (including Turkic and Mongolic), Kartvelian, and Slavic languages. Dr. Bondarenko's work is recognized for integrating fieldwork methodologies into the exploration of linguistic structures. She has an active role in advancing research in her areas of specialty, working to document and analyze under-researched languages. Tanya is currently on leave for the academic year 2025-26.
